Inspiring advances in bioprocessing, Repligen is a leader in bioprocess filtration, pre-packed chromatography and Protein A ligands development. Propelled by a culture of innovation and collaboration, and with a focus on cost and process efficiencies, our people and our technologies help meet critical bioproduction demands worldwide. Named one of the fastest growing biotech companies in the USA, Repligen is headquartered in Waltham, Massachusetts with major manufacturing sites in Massachusetts, California, Sweden, and Germany.
The Field Service Engineer (FSE) is responsible for installing, maintaining and servicing Repligen products; XCell ™ ATF and Spectrum TFF filtration throughout the US. The FSE will provide remote and onsite support and work closely with the sales and product managers in troubleshooting customer needs. The FSE shall maintain accurate documentation of all service activities and escalating issues as needed. The role cover the greater Chicago metropolitan area, northern Indiana and southern Michigan.

Our Products
Repligen offers the broadest range of hollow fiber and flat sheet filtration technologies for cell culture and purification, featuring XCell® ATF Systems, Spectrum® KrosFlo TFF Filters and Systems and TangenX® Flat Sheet TFF Cassettes. As the expert in pre-packed chromatography technology, Repligen offers OPUS® Pre-packed Columns with unparalleled flexibility and scalability from bench- to production-scale. Since 1985, Protein A affinity ligands manufactured by Repligen have been routinely used to purify most of the world’s monoclonal antibodies.
